It has been a difficult year so at first glance I may not have much to be thankful for. My mother was diagnosed with cancer and passed on May 26th, my nephew wa so devastated at the loss of his grandmother that he hit a rough patch and went into a deep depression. Then 4 weeks ago their house (meaning my nephews) burned down and they lost everything. One would think having a year like that would leave little to be thankful for but I've come to the conclusion that is not the case. This year I am thankful that my mother passed. It brought the family much closer together and although she is gone and terribly missed, we are a tighter stronger family for having made it through her illness by her side. We will always miss her but we will miss her together. I'm thankful that my nephews house burned down. This woke my nephew up from his horrible depression and reminded him there is still a world out there and he was needed in it. He was able to have a fund raiser with his friends and all they lost - and a bit more - was given back whole and new. He has a new spirit now and a fresh outlook on life. It's really simple to look at what we've suffered through and say there is nothing to be thankful for, but if you look closely you will find that's not true.
